Как безопасно сохранить базу данных в Pgadmin и избежать потери важной информации

Сохранение базы данных является важной операцией для обеспечения безопасности и надежности вашего проекта. Одним из самых популярных инструментов для работы с базами данных PostgreSQL является Pgadmin. В этой статье мы рассмотрим, как сохранить базу данных в Pgadmin и обеспечить ее сохранность.

Перед сохранением базы данных в Pgadmin, убедитесь, что вы имеете доступ к серверу баз данных и достаточные привилегии для выполнения этой операции. Это важный аспект, который поможет избежать потери данных и ошибок в процессе сохранения.

Для сохранения базы данных в Pgadmin, откройте программу и выберите сервер баз данных, с которым вы хотите работать. В меню слева найдите раздел «Базы данных» и щелкните правой кнопкой мыши на базе данных, которую нужно сохранить. В контекстном меню выберите опцию «Сохранить как» и укажите путь для сохранения файла с расширением «.backup». Это создаст резервную копию базы данных со всеми ее таблицами и данными.

Важно помнить, что сохранение базы данных может занять некоторое время, особенно если база данных очень большая или содержит много данных. Поэтому рекомендуется установить расписание для регулярного сохранения базы данных, чтобы минимизировать риск потери данных.

В случае необходимости восстановления базы данных из сохраненного файла, откройте Pgadmin, выберите нужный сервер баз данных и щелкните правой кнопкой мыши на разделе «Базы данных». В контекстном меню выберите опцию «Восстановить» и укажите путь к файлу резервной копии. После этого Pgadmin восстановит базу данных из указанного файла и восстановит все ее таблицы и данные.

Создание резервной копии базы данных

Один из способов — использование инструмента «pg_dump». Он позволяет создать дамп базы данных в формате SQL. Для создания резервной копии с использованием «pg_dump» нужно выполнить следующую команду в Pgadmin:

pg_dump -U username -h hostname -d database_name > backup_file.sql

Здесь:

  • username — имя пользователя базы данных
  • hostname — имя хоста базы данных
  • database_name — имя базы данных
  • backup_file.sql — имя файла, в который будет сохранена резервная копия

После выполнения этой команды будет создан файл «backup_file.sql», содержащий SQL-скрипт, позволяющий восстановить базу данных.

Еще один способ — использование графического интерфейса Pgadmin. Для создания резервной копии базы данных с помощью Pgadmin нужно выполнить следующие шаги:

  1. Открыть Pgadmin и подключиться к серверу с базой данных, которую вы хотите скопировать.
  2. Щелкнуть правой кнопкой мыши на базе данных и выбрать опцию «Backup».
  3. В открывшемся окне настроить параметры бэкапа, такие как формат файла, расположение и имя файла, опции сжатия и т.д.
  4. Нажать кнопку «Backup» для начала создания резервной копии.

После выполнения этих шагов будет создан файл с указанными параметрами и расширением, содержащий бэкап базы данных.

Таким образом, создание резервной копии базы данных в Pgadmin можно выполнить как с использованием инструмента «pg_dump», так и с помощью графического интерфейса Pgadmin.

Выбор формата сохранения

При сохранении базы данных в Pgadmin вы можете выбрать один из нескольких форматов файлов:

ФорматОписание
SQLФормат SQL является стандартным форматом для сохранения баз данных. При выборе этого формата, база данных будет сохранена в виде SQL-скрипта, который можно восстановить в любой момент для восстановления данных.
CSVФормат CSV (Comma-Separated Values) представляет данные в виде текстового файла, где поля разделены запятой. Этот формат удобен для передачи данных между различными приложениями.
JSONФормат JSON (JavaScript Object Notation) используется для хранения и обмена данными. База данных будет сохранена в виде JSON-файла, который можно легко прочитать и использовать в других приложениях.
XMLФормат XML (eXtensible Markup Language) позволяет представлять данные в структурированном виде. При выборе этого формата, база данных будет сохранена в XML-файле, который может быть анализирован и использован для обмена данными между различными системами.

При выборе формата сохранения базы данных в Pgadmin, учтите требования вашего проекта и необходимость возможного восстановления данных в будущем.

Запуск процесса сохранения

Чтобы сохранить базу данных в PgAdmin, следуйте этим простым шагам:

  1. Откройте Приложение PgAdmin и войдите в учетную запись администратора.
  2. В левой панели выберите сервер, на котором находится база данных, которую вы хотите сохранить.
  3. Щелкните правой кнопкой мыши на базе данных и выберите опцию «Резервное копирование…».
  4. В появившемся окне выберите целевое расположение для сохранения резервной копии.
  5. Выберите формат сохранения (например, TAR или Plain).
  6. Укажите опции резервного копирования, такие как метод сжатия и включение данных или схем.
  7. Нажмите кнопку «OK», чтобы начать процесс сохранения базы данных.

После завершения процесса база данных будет сохранена в выбранном вами расположении в указанном формате. Вы можете использовать эту резервную копию для восстановления базы данных в будущем или для переноса базы данных на другой сервер.

Место для сохранения резервной копии

1. Хранилище: выберите надежное и безопасное место для хранения резервной копии. Это может быть внешний жесткий диск, сетевое хранилище (NAS), облачное хранилище или другое подходящее устройство.

2. Доступность: убедитесь, что вы имеете доступ к выбранному месту для сохранения резервной копии. Важно, чтобы вы могли легко получить доступ к данным в случае необходимости.

3. Расположение: рекомендуется сохранять резервную копию базы данных вне самой базы данных. Если база данных повреждается или теряется, резервная копия не будет затронута и останется безопасной.

4. Регулярность: установите регулярное расписание для создания и сохранения резервных копий. Это поможет избежать потери данных и обеспечит актуальность резервной копии.

5. Тестирование: проверяйте резервную копию регулярно, чтобы быть уверенным в ее целостности и возможности восстановления данных.

Выбор места для сохранения резервной копии базы данных играет важную роль в обеспечении ее безопасности и доступности. Следуйте указанным выше рекомендациям, чтобы убедиться, что ваша резервная копия защищена и готова к восстановлению в случае необходимости.

Планирование регулярного сохранения

Для обеспечения безопасности данных и предотвращения потери информации, рекомендуется регулярно сохранять базу данных в Pgadmin. Для этого можно использовать функциональность резервного копирования, предоставляемую Pgadmin.

Сохранение базы данных можно выполнять с определенной периодичностью, например, ежедневно, еженедельно или месячно. В зависимости от важности данных и частоты их изменений, можно выбрать оптимальный график сохранения.

Для планирования регулярного сохранения базы данных в Pgadmin можно использовать инструмент «Расписание заданий». Для этого необходимо выполнить следующие шаги:

1Открыть Pgadmin и выбрать нужную базу данных.
2Нажать правой кнопкой мыши на базе данных и выбрать «Резервное копирование».
3В появившемся окне выбрать параметры сохранения, такие как формат файла, место сохранения и другие опции.
4Нажать на кнопку «Планирование задания».
5Выбрать периодичность сохранения, время начала и другие настройки расписания.
6Подтвердить настройки и сохранить задание.

После завершения этих шагов Pgadmin будет автоматически выполнять резервное копирование базы данных в соответствии с заданным расписанием. Это позволит сохранить данные и обеспечить их безопасность при возможных сбоях или неожиданных ситуациях.

Отладка сохранения: ошибки и их устранение

Сохранение базы данных в Pgadmin может столкнуться с различными ошибками, которые необходимо устранить для успешного выполнения операции. Ниже приведены некоторые распространенные проблемы и способы их устранения.

1. Ошибка подключения к серверу: если вы получаете сообщение об ошибке «Не удалось подключиться к серверу», убедитесь, что вы ввели правильные учетные данные для доступа к серверу. Проверьте имя пользователя, пароль и адрес сервера.

2. Недостаточно привилегий: если вы получаете сообщение «У вас нет прав для выполнения этой операции», убедитесь, что ваш пользователь имеет достаточные привилегии для сохранения базы данных. Обратитесь к администратору или разработчику для уточнения прав доступа.

3. Ошибка синтаксиса: если во время сохранения базы данных происходит ошибка синтаксиса, убедитесь, что вы правильно ввели команды SQL. Проверьте наличие правильных ключевых слов и правильную структуру запроса.

4. Недостаточно места на диске: если у вас заканчивается место на диске во время сохранения базы данных, освободите необходимое место или выберите другое место для сохранения. Убедитесь, что у вас достаточно свободного места для хранения базы данных.

5. Сбой соединения: если во время сохранения базы данных происходит сбой соединения, убедитесь, что у вас стабильное интернет-соединение или соединение с сервером базы данных. Проверьте настройки сети и устраните возможные проблемы с соединением.

6. Блокировка базы данных: если база данных заблокирована другим пользователем или процессом, вы не сможете ее сохранить. Попробуйте снова выполнить операцию сохранения после того, как другой пользователь или процесс освободит базу данных.

ОшибкаУстранение
Ошибка подключения к серверуПроверить учетные данные и адрес сервера
Недостаточно привилегийЗапросить достаточные привилегии у администратора
Ошибка синтаксисаПроверить правильность команд SQL
Недостаточно места на дискеОсвободить место на диске или выбрать другое место для сохранения
Сбой соединенияПроверить соединение с интернетом или сервером базы данных
Блокировка базы данныхДождаться освобождения базы данных

Восстановление базы данных из резервной копии

Для восстановления базы данных в Pgadmin, необходимо выполнить следующие шаги:

  1. Откройте Pgadmin и подключитесь к серверу.
  2. Выберите базу данных, к которой вы хотите применить резервную копию.
  3. Нажмите правой кнопкой мыши на выбранную базу данных и выберите опцию «Восстановить».
  4. В открывшемся окне выберите резервную копию, которую вы хотите восстановить.
  5. Укажите путь для временных файлов, созданных в процессе восстановления.
  6. Установите параметры восстановления, такие как база данных назначения, схема, владелец и т. д.
  7. Нажмите кнопку «Восстановить» и дождитесь окончания процесса восстановления.

После завершения процесса восстановления, база данных будет восстановлена из резервной копии и будет доступна для использования. Рекомендуется регулярно создавать резервные копии базы данных и хранить их в безопасном месте для обеспечения защиты данных.

Важные моменты, о которых нужно помнить при сохранении базы данных

  1. Регулярное создание резервных копий: Создание резервных копий базы данных — обязательное условие для обеспечения безопасности информации. Планируйте регулярное создание резервных копий и сохраняйте их на надежных носителях.

  2. Выбор правильного формата и места хранения: При сохранении базы данных установите правильный формат и выберите надежное место хранения. Используйте сжатие данных для уменьшения объема информации и выберите надежное хранилище данных, обеспечивающее защиту от потери файлов.

  3. Проверка целостности данных: Перед сохранением базы данных рекомендуется проверить целостность данных. Выполните анализ базы данных на предмет ошибок и устраните их перед сохранением, чтобы избежать непредвиденных проблем в будущем.

  4. Документирование процесса сохранения: Важно документировать процесс сохранения базы данных, чтобы иметь полную информацию о каждом шаге. Запишите важные параметры, используемые при сохранении, а также результаты выполнения задачи. Это поможет вам повторить операцию или восстановить базу данных, если это потребуется.

  5. Тестирование восстановления: После сохранения базы данных рекомендуется провести тестирование процедуры восстановления. Проверьте, что данные успешно восстанавливаются и работают корректно после восстановления. Это поможет вам быть уверенным в сохранности ваших данных.

Следуя этим важным моментам, вы сможете успешно сохранить базу данных в Pgadmin и обеспечить ее надежность и безопасность.

Оцените статью